Differentiate between:
Interactive Audio Lesson
Listen to a student-teacher conversation explaining the topic in a relatable way.
Parallel-In Parallel-Out Shift Register
🔒 Unlock Audio Lesson
Sign up and enroll to listen to this audio lesson
Okay class, let’s start by discussing what a parallel-in parallel-out shift register is. Can anyone tell me how it differs from a parallel-in serial-out shift register?
Is it because it outputs data from all flip-flops simultaneously?
Exactly, well done! The parallel-in parallel-out shift register outputs data from all flip-flops at once, unlike the serial-out counterpart which shifts data out one bit at a time. This is crucial for speeding up data processing. Remember the acronym PIPO for this kind of register.
So, does an example of this register include IC 74199?
Yes, IC 74199 is a prime example. Let’s remember that when we think about real-time applications, PIPO helps in faster data handling!
Bidirectional Shift Register
🔒 Unlock Audio Lesson
Sign up and enroll to listen to this audio lesson
Now, let’s move to the concept of bidirectional shift registers. Why do you think bidirectional shift registers are beneficial?
They allow shifting data in both ways, making them more versatile, right?
Correct! The flexibility of shifting data left or right adds significant functionality in circuits requiring reversible data processing. Always think of the control input that facilitates this action!
Could you provide a real-life application of this?
Sure! In digital communication, bidirectional shift registers can help in encoding and decoding data. They could act as an interface in managing signals!
Universal Shift Register
🔒 Unlock Audio Lesson
Sign up and enroll to listen to this audio lesson
Next, we need to talk about the universal shift register, commonly represented by IC 74194. What sets it apart from other shift registers?
It can operate in multiple modes including serial in serial out, right or left shifts?
Precisely! The universal nature of this register makes it extremely adaptable, allowing for various input and output data configurations. Let’s apply the abbreviation ‘USR’.
What about the timing operations, might you explain those?
Of course! Each different mode has its specific timing dictated by the clock's transitions. For example, parallel loading occurs on specific clock signals, distinguishing how data is processed over time.
Ring Counter
🔒 Unlock Audio Lesson
Sign up and enroll to listen to this audio lesson
Let's explore the ring counter. What do you think makes a ring counter unique in how it counts?
It uses a circular shift where the output of one flip-flop feeds into the next, right?
Yes! This continuous cycling results in the counter outputs that repeat every certain number of clock pulses. Everyone should remember it as a circulating register.
Can this be applied in modern digital systems?
Absolutely! They are often used in sequence control applications in digital installations. A mnemonic to keep this in your mind could be: 'Circle Counts Consistently'!
Shift Counter
🔒 Unlock Audio Lesson
Sign up and enroll to listen to this audio lesson
Now we’ll discuss shift counters, also known as Johnson counters. How do they differ from traditional counters?
They have flipped feedback from their outputs, which gives them a unique pattern of counting?
Correct! The shift counter achieves a unique MOD number that is double the number of flip-flops. This difference allows for counting that is more efficient in certain applications. A mnemonic to remember might be: 'Shift Shapes Sequence' for understanding their counting approach.
What practical uses could shift counters have?
They can be used in digital clocks and timing applications because of their predictable counting patterns!
Introduction & Overview
Read summaries of the section's main ideas at different levels of detail.
Quick Overview
Standard
In this section, we explore various types of shift registers and counters including parallel-in parallel-out, bidirectional, universal shift registers, and the difference between ring and Johnson counters. The significance of each type in data handling and processing is examined.
Detailed
Differentiation of Shift Registers and Counters
This section covers the major classifications and implementations of shift registers and counters in the realm of digital electronics. It begins with an overview of Parallel-In Parallel-Out (PIPO) shift registers, such as the IC 74199, which allow simultaneous input and output of data. The Bidirectional Shift Register concept allows for data shifting in either direction through gating logic control while the Universal Shift Register (like the IC 74194) can function in any shift register mode (serial or parallel in both input and output).
Furthermore, the section explains the operation of shift register counters, particularly focusing on the Ring Counter which maintains a circular state and the Johnson Counter, characterized by its flipped feedback mechanism. Key elucidations on the working, advantages, and applications of these components are instrumental in understanding the flow and manipulation of digital data, considerably enhancing the operational capabilities of digital systems.
Youtube Videos
Audio Book
Dive deep into the subject with an immersive audiobook experience.
Asynchronous vs. Synchronous Counters
Chapter 1 of 4
🔒 Unlock Audio Chapter
Sign up and enroll to access the full audio experience
Chapter Content
Asynchronous counters operate without a clock signal synchronizing all flip-flops, while synchronous counters have all flip-flops triggered by a common clock signal.
Detailed Explanation
In asynchronous counters, each flip-flop is triggered by the previous one, meaning the change in output is not uniform across the entire counter. This can lead to delays and inaccuracies as each flip-flop takes time to respond to the change in the previous flip-flop's output. On the other hand, synchronous counters receive triggering from the same clock signal, ensuring all flip-flops change their outputs simultaneously, allowing for more reliable and faster counting.
Examples & Analogies
Think of asynchronous counters like a group of people passing a message one after another; as soon as one person hears it, they start repeating it, but not all at once, leading to delays. In contrast, synchronous counters are like a choir, all singing in perfect harmony at the same time, making the sound clear and synchronized.
UP, DOWN, and UP/DOWN Counters
Chapter 2 of 4
🔒 Unlock Audio Chapter
Sign up and enroll to access the full audio experience
Chapter Content
UP counters count in an increasing order, DOWN counters count in a decreasing order, while UP/DOWN counters can count in both directions.
Detailed Explanation
An UP counter increments its count with each clock pulse, showing a sequence like 0, 1, 2, 3, etc. Conversely, a DOWN counter decrements its count, producing a sequence such as 3, 2, 1, 0. An UP/DOWN counter is versatile, able to switch between increasing and decreasing depending on a control input, allowing it to count up or down based on requirements.
Examples & Analogies
Imagine a staircase: the UP counter is like someone walking up the stairs, step by step. The DOWN counter is someone walking down the stairs. The UP/DOWN counter is akin to a person who can choose to go either up or down depending on where they want to go.
Presettable vs. Clearable Counters
Chapter 3 of 4
🔒 Unlock Audio Chapter
Sign up and enroll to access the full audio experience
Chapter Content
Presettable counters can be set to a specific value before starting to count, while clearable counters can be reset to zero or a defined value during operation.
Detailed Explanation
A presettable counter is designed to allow users to load a specified numerical value into the counter before it begins counting, making it useful for applications requiring starting from a number other than zero. In contrast, a clearable counter can be reset during its operation to start counting anew from zero or any other specified value when necessary.
Examples & Analogies
Think of a presettable counter like a combination lock where you can set your own combination before locking it. A clearable counter is like a scoreboard that can be reset whenever you want to start a new game; you can clear the existing score and begin counting from zero again.
BCD vs. Decade Counters
Chapter 4 of 4
🔒 Unlock Audio Chapter
Sign up and enroll to access the full audio experience
Chapter Content
BCD (Binary-Coded Decimal) counters count from 0 to 9 (10 states) and then reset, while decade counters count in decimal sequences based on powers of ten.
Detailed Explanation
A BCD counter represents each decimal digit using its binary equivalent, thus only counting through values 0-9 before resetting. It is useful when dealing with decimal-based applications. A decade counter, however, counts ten distinct states (for instance, from 0 to 9) and immediately resets back to zero, typically functioning in applications where counting to ten is necessary.
Examples & Analogies
Imagine a BCD counter as a digital clock that only shows hours and minutes without going past the number nine for hours. Once it hits 9:59, it resets to 0:00. A decade counter, on the other hand, is like a scorecard in a game for ten seconds countdown: you count each second, and once it touches 10 seconds, you restart from zero.
Key Concepts
-
Parallel-In Parallel-Out Shift Register: Outputs data simultaneously from all flip-flops.
-
Bidirectional Shift Register: Shifts data in both directions.
-
Universal Shift Register: Functions in multiple shift modes.
-
Ring Counter: A counter that circulates a single bit.
-
Johnson Counter: A modified counter that uses inverted feedback.
Examples & Applications
IC 74199 as a representative of Parallel-In Parallel-Out shift registers.
IC 74194 as a capable Universal Shift Register.
The application of a bidirectional shift register in communication systems for data encoding.
Memory Aids
Interactive tools to help you remember key concepts
Rhymes
In the ring counter, a single bit does twirl, shifting right, it's a dance that fastens the world.
Stories
Imagine a digital post office where letters are sent around in circles, only one letter gets to be read at a time, just like a ring counter.
Memory Tools
Remember 'USR' - Universal Shift Register, for all modes of data to flow!
Acronyms
PIPO - for Parallel-In Parallel-Out, processing data in one quick shot!
Flash Cards
Glossary
- Shift Register
A storage device that allows data to be moved, or shifted, through a series of registers.
- IC 74199
An example of a parallel-in parallel-out shift register.
- Bidirectional Shift Register
A shift register that can shift data in either left or right direction.
- Universal Shift Register
A shift register that can operate in any shift mode.
- Ring Counter
A type of counter that recirculates a single bit through all flip-flops.
- Johnson Counter
A modified ring counter that utilizes inverse feedback to produce a distinct count sequence.
Reference links
Supplementary resources to enhance your learning experience.